Hi ,

Regarding bugs on XR platform , i cant find what means under known fixed releases  fourth number in XR version 

Known Fixed Releases:
(7)
6.1.3.6i.BASE
6.1.31.3i.BASE
6.1.32.2i.BASE
6.2.1.25i.BASE
6.2.1 is version ? , and what means 25i ???

When IOS XR release is in preparation, we are building an image for internal test purposes every week. The version number of the weekly build is the fourth nibble. When the testing is completed and we are ready to post the binaries to cisco.com, we cut the fourth nibble.

In other words, this is how to decompose 6.2.1.25i:

  • 6.2: major release number
  • 1: minor release number
  • 25i: pre-release (internal) version number.
